Output ef24dedba6929e7a375eeacebfd357e97f78c19590d94cf25ebe79a9c3887394:4

value
67700853
script pubkey
OP_0 OP_PUSHBYTES_32 027b58afb4c4f8c5e78fda7bfd11aeb8189449df26a10b6efa2c55a1dedf0ad6
address
bc1qqfa43ta5cnuvteu0mfal6ydwhqvfgjwly6sskmh69326rhklpttqhuhhyw
transaction
ef24dedba6929e7a375eeacebfd357e97f78c19590d94cf25ebe79a9c3887394
confirmations
122582
spent
true